Overview
In 2024, Arrah averaged an AQI of 123 while Bikaner averaged 154 — a 31-point (25%) gap, with Bikaner the more polluted and Arrah the cleaner of the two. On 505 days when both cities reported, Arrah was cleaner on 332 of them; the average daily gap was 62 AQI points.
Seasonality & days
Both cities see their worst air in January on average. Arrah logged 0.2% Severe days and 32.3% Good-or-Satisfactory days; Bikaner was 0.1% Severe and 21.6% Good-or-Satisfactory. Longest clean-air streaks: Arrah 11 days, Bikaner 15 days.
Year-over-year progress
Arrah has improved by 175 AQI points (58.7%) from 2021 to 2024; Bikaner has improved by 16 AQI points (9.4%) over the same window. The worst recorded day for Arrah reached AQI 420 at New DM Office (BSPCB) on 2021-12-21; Bikaner hit AQI 403 at MM Ground (RSPCB) on 2024-11-17.
